January

January can be very chilly. Temperatures average in the low 50s F (low 10s C) during the day. It rains once in a while.

February

If you visit Vasto during February, you are likely to notice that it can be brisk. Temperatures tend to hover around the low 50s F (low 10s C) during the day, while at night they can dip into the low 40s F (single digits C). In terms of precipitation, you can expect it to rain once in a while.
